Choosing the Right Hardware for Your Concrete Post

The success of fixing a gate to a concrete fence post depends heavily on the fasteners you choose. You cannot use standard nails or screws; instead, you need heavy-duty anchors that can grip the dense internal structure of the concrete. Expansion bolts are a popular choice for high-load gates, while chemical anchors (epoxy) are preferred for maximum vibration resistance and waterproofing. Selecting the wrong hardware often leads to "wobble" within a few months of use. It is also vital to ensure all hardware is galvanized or stainless steel to prevent rust streaks from staining your clean concrete posts.

Pro Tip: Always drill 2-3mm wider than the diameter of your anchor bolt to ensure a smooth insertion, but avoid over-drilling, which can compromise the grip strength of the expansion sleeve.

Step-by-Step Guide to Fixing a Gate to a Concrete Fence Post

Achieving a professional finish requires precision and the right tools. First, position your gate and mark the exact points where the hinges will meet the concrete. Use a hammer drill with a masonry bit to create clean holes. Once drilled, clear the dust using a blow-out bulb or vacuum; dust left in the hole can reduce the bonding strength of your anchors by up to 30%. After inserting the anchors, align your hinge plates and tighten the bolts firmly. Finally, check the gate's swing and level it using a spirit level before the final tightening. Comparing Fixing Methods for Concrete Posts

Depending on the weight of your gate and the type of concrete post, you may choose between different installation methods. While mechanical expansion is fast, chemical bonding is often more permanent. When fixing a gate to a concrete fence post, consider the frequency of use—heavy commercial gates require more robust anchoring than a light garden wicket gate. Below is a comparison of the most common professional methods.

Method Installation Speed Load Capacity Durability
Expansion Bolts Fast Medium-High Good
Chemical Anchors Slow (Curing time) Very High Excellent
Sleeve Anchors Medium Medium Fair

Preventing Gate Sag in Concrete Post Installations

One of the biggest challenges when fixing a gate to a concrete fence post is preventing the gate from sagging over time. Sagging occurs when the hinges pull away from the post or the gate frame warps. To prevent this, always install a diagonal brace on the gate frame, running from the bottom hinge corner to the top latch corner. Additionally, using heavy-duty "J-bolts" that are cast directly into the concrete during the pouring process provides the ultimate resistance to sagging, as the bolt becomes a permanent part of the post's core.

Product Specifications for Optimal Post Selection

Not all concrete posts are created equal. For the purpose of fixing a gate to a concrete fence post, you need a post with high compressive strength and minimal internal voids. Reinforced concrete posts with steel rebar cores are highly recommended because they distribute the tension load from the gate hinges across the entire length of the post. Below are the recommended specifications for gate-supporting posts.

Specification Recommended Value Purpose
Concrete Grade C30 or higher Ensures anchor grip strength
Post Dimension Min 100mm x 100mm Prevents post flexion
Reinforcement Steel Rebar Core Increases tensile strength
Surface Finish Smooth Cast Aesthetic appeal and weather resistance

Can I use regular wood screws for fixing a gate to a concrete post?

Absolutely not. Wood screws are designed to grip organic fibers, which are non-existent in concrete. Attempting to use them will result in the screw simply sliding out or snapping. For fixing a gate to a concrete fence post, you must use masonry anchors, expansion bolts, or chemical epoxy resins. These are specifically engineered to expand against the walls of a drilled hole in concrete, creating a high-friction mechanical bond that can support the heavy weight of a swinging gate.

What happens if I drill into the steel reinforcement bar (rebar) inside the post?

Hitting rebar is common during installation. If your drill bit stops moving forward and you feel a hard, metallic resistance, you have likely hit a rebar. It is generally not recommended to drill through the rebar as it can weaken the structural integrity of the post. The best practice is to slightly shift your hinge position by a few millimeters and drill a new hole. If you must go through it, you will need a high-quality carbide-tipped masonry bit or a cobalt bit capable of cutting through steel.

How do I stop a concrete post from cracking when tightening the bolts?

Concrete can crack if too much localized pressure is applied, especially near the edges of the post. To prevent this, ensure you are drilling the holes at least 50mm to 75mm away from the edge of the post. Additionally, avoid over-tightening expansion bolts with a heavy-duty impact wrench; instead, use a hand wrench to feel the tension. If you are dealing with older or more brittle concrete, switching to chemical anchors is a safer bet as they bond chemically without creating the outward radial pressure that expansion bolts do.

Which is better: expansion bolts or chemical anchors for gate installation?

Expansion bolts are better for DIY projects and lighter gates because they are fast and inexpensive. However, for heavy-duty gates or areas with high vibration, chemical anchors are superior. They fill the entire hole, creating a waterproof seal and a bond that is often stronger than the concrete itself.
